Partial Fire at the Jérémie BED

On Tuesday, July 21, 2026, a fire broke out in part of the Jérémie Departmental Electoral Bureau (BED) building. No official information is available regarding the cause of the fire or the extent of the damage. An investigation has been opened.

Large-Scale Operation in Kenscoff by the PNH

The Haitian National Police (PNH) conducted a large-scale operation in the commune of Kenscoff, in the localities of Godet, Furcy, and Bois d’Avril. The operation involved several specialized units, armored vehicles, helicopters, and kamikaze drones. Several bandits were killed, according to Kenscoff Mayor Massillon Jean. No official casualty figures are available at this time.

Grenadiers U-20 Victory [3-0] Against Cañoneros

The final test before the big match. Before their first qualifying match for the 2026 Concacaf U-20 Champions League, Haiti's U-20 national team played a friendly against Cañoneros FC on Tuesday, July 21st at 7:00 PM. The U-20 national team won [3-0]. The goals were scored by: Emerson Laissé, Clavens Exantus, and John Peter Charles. Two PNH officers dead in 24 hours, suicide ?

Two officers of the Haitian National Police (PNH) were found dead in less than 24 hours in Delmas, in circumstances unofficially presented as suspected suicides pending the results of the investigation. The first officer, Brunel d’Haïti, assigned to the Departmental Operations and Intervention Brigade (BOID), shot himself in Delmas 33 after leaving a letter for his family. According to initial reports, he was battling an illness that caused depression. The second, Yane Fleurimis, a member of the 22nd graduating class of the Haitian National Police (PNH) and assigned to the Penitentiary Administration Directorate (DAP), was found dead early Monday, July 20.

The PNH receives a UN delegation

On Tuesday, July 21, 2026, Vladimir Paraison, Acting Director General of the Haitian National Police (PNH), accompanied by members of the High Command, received a United Nations delegation to discuss the current security situation in Haiti. Held at PNH Headquarters, this meeting allowed senior PNH officials and members of the UN delegation to exchange views on several issues related to the country's security situation, including the PNH's operational capabilities and the security measures implemented on the ground, all within a spirit of institutional cooperation and strategic consultation.

Tabarre : Clarification

The Tabarre Municipal Commission informs the general public that, to date, no contract has been signed between the Tabarre City Hall and any company, firm, or individual regarding the road construction project linking Carrefour Ritha to the Motorized Intervention Brigade (BIM) headquarters. The administration has only made fifty million (50,000,000) gourdes available for the project. The City Hall is directly responsible for acquiring the construction materials, while the Ministry of Public Works is providing technical support by supplying engineers, technicians, workers, and the necessary equipment and materials for the successful completion of the work.
